Photographer Bertrand Stofleth (born 1978) journeyed down the Rhone river, from its Swiss glacial spring to its mouth in the Mediterranean Sea, setting out to methodically follow its course and chart its immediate surroundings. This book compiles the large-format images of the landscape in its sometimes domesticated, sometimes wild state.

Le projet Rhodanie est une série photographique documentaire de Bertrand Stofleth qui a parcouru le fleuve Rhône depuis sa source sur le glacier en Suisse jusqu'à la mer Méditerranée. Sont présentées dans cette édition "grand format", les images réalisées sur le tronçon méridional, de Pont-Saint-Esprit à la mer Méditerranée, qui invitent à regarder autrement ce qui se joue après les inondations, entre la nature - sauvage ou domestiquée - et les hommes qui habitent ces territoires riverains du fleuve.

Landscape architecture and photography are closely interrelated, since the former is a constantly evolving thing that can be captured in stills, even eternalized, by photography. What role does photography play in landscape design? How does photography create a new context for landscape? The book investigates such questions in nine essays by North-American and French scientists, using landscape designs that were created from the 1950s to today.

Ce catalogue accompagne la grande exposition Paysages français présentée à la BnF du 24 octobre 2017 au 4 février 2018, rétrospective majeure qui retrace 30 ans de missions photographiques sur le territoire français (les missions photographiques de la DATAR, de France(s) territoire liquide, du Conservatoire du littoral ou de l’Observatoire photographique du paysage, notamment). L’ouvrage, riche de 270 reproductions, présente les travaux de plus d’une centaine de photographes (Robert Doisneau, Raymond Depardon, Thibaut Cuisset, Michaël Kenna ou encore Elina Brotherus et Bernard Plossu...). Il donne les clés pour comprendre l’évolution du paysage français des années 1980 à nos jours, celle de sa mise en image, et présente les visages d’une France multiple et en mutation.

Images are just as much in motion as people. In a globalized world they can move faster and more freely than humans. When artist Armin Linke was invited more than seven years ago to participate in a photographic project on the island of Lampedusa, he left his camera at home because he thought that there would already be plenty of photos available there. Instead, he took with him on the trip a team from the Karlsruhe University of Arts and Design so that they could talk with local image makers about their photographs. Four years later, he approached Spector Books about the possibility of turning the photos and interview material he had collected into a book. The publishing house studied the pictures and suggested adopting the form of a photo-graphic novel, in which drawings comment on the photographs, thus creating an external perspective on the images.
